What Makes International Casinos Different

Non GamStop casinos run under licences issued in places like Curacao, Malta, or Gibraltar. They’re not bound by the same UK Gambling Commission rules, which means they can offer more generous bonuses, faster withdrawals, and a broader game library that includes titles from providers UK sites often skip. They also tend to support cryptocurrency payments, which is a major draw for players who value transaction speed and privacy.

But here’s the trade-off: you carry more responsibility for managing your own gambling. The built-in safety nets of the UK system – like GamStop itself or mandatory deposit limits – aren’t guaranteed. Some international casinos do offer responsible gambling tools. Others don’t. You have to check.

How to Evaluate a Non GamStop Casino

Not every international casino is worth your time. The ones that are tend to share a few traits. Look for these before you sign up:

  1. Licensing and security – Verify the casino holds a recognised international licence and uses SSL encryption to protect your data.
  2. Bonus terms – Read the wagering requirements, time limits, and eligible games before you claim anything. A 500% bonus is useless if you can’t actually clear it.
  3. Withdrawal speed – Some casinos pay out within hours, especially with e-wallets or crypto. Others take days. Check the processing times before you deposit.
  4. Customer support – Test the live chat before you need it. Responsive support is a sign of a well-run operator.

Payment Methods at a Glance

International casinos typically support a wider range of payment methods than UK-regulated sites. Here’s how the main options stack up:

Method Deposit Speed Withdrawal Speed Privacy Level
Debit/Credit Cards Instant 1-3 days Standard
Digital Wallets Instant Under 24 hours Good
Cryptocurrencies Near-instant Minutes to hours High
Bank Transfer 1-2 days 3-7 days Standard

Cryptocurrency support is a big differentiator. It’s not just about speed – it’s about avoiding the friction that banks sometimes apply to gambling transactions.
